Liquid Silk Lubricant and Material Compatibility

Not all toys and surfaces respond the same way to every lubricant. Silicone toys, porous materials, metal, glass, and rubber-like compounds can each behave differently. The safest approach is to match the lubricant type to the item material and follow the toy manufacturer guidance if it is available.

In practice, you can improve compatibility by using small amounts at first, then observing how the product feels. If the surface becomes tacky or starts to break down quickly, consider switching to a different lubricant style or a formulation intended for that material category. This is one of the simplest ways to protect both comfort and the longevity of your items.

Why surface type changes the glide

Friction is affected by texture, porosity, and surface finish. A smooth, non-porous surface can allow even distribution, while a more textured or porous material may hold lubricant differently. When lubricant is absorbed or redistributed unevenly, you may notice dry patches sooner or a change in sensation. Selecting a silk-style lubricant that spreads evenly helps reduce this problem for many users.

Quick Tips

Use these short steps to get better results from a liquid silk lubricant while keeping routine care simple.

  • Start small: Apply a modest amount, then add only if the feel needs improvement.
  • Distribute evenly: Gently spread the lubricant to create consistent coverage instead of concentrated spots.
  • Use the right amount for the motion: Faster or higher-friction movements may require more frequent topping up, but gradual application is usually more effective than overdoing it.
  • Consider warming during use: Some formulas feel more fluid after they warm to body temperature. Start slowly and reassess after a few minutes.
  • Clean after use: Rinse or wash with a compatible cleaner according to your toy material. Dry thoroughly before storing.
  • Store correctly: Keep products sealed and away from heat or direct sunlight to support stable texture.
  • Patch test when unsure: If you are testing a new product or new toy, try a small area first to verify compatibility.
  • Avoid mixing incompatible types: If you switch between lubricant styles, residues may affect texture. When in doubt, clean and reset.

How to Apply and Reapply Comfortably

Application habits can matter as much as the product itself. For a silk-style feel, the most common mistake is applying too much at once. Excess lubricant can cause slip that feels less controlled and can lead to faster cleanup needs. A better method is to apply lightly, move slowly to distribute, then reassess.

When you do reapply, focus on the friction zone rather than the entire surface. This approach reduces waste and helps maintain a consistent feel. If the sensation changes quickly, do not immediately assume the product is wrong. Consider whether the toy surface may need a rinse and whether the amount used was sufficient to create stable, even coverage.

Cleaning is the next step that supports long-term performance. After use, remove residue carefully, then wash based on material guidance. Drying thoroughly helps prevent odor and reduces the chance of residue buildup. Proper care also makes it easier to enjoy the same comfort in future sessions because the surface remains ready for even glide.

Q&A Section

Is a liquid silk lubricant safe for all toy materials?

Compatibility depends on the toy material and finish. Silk-style lubricants are often used on many non-porous surfaces, but you should still patch test when you are unsure. For porous materials or unknown finishes, verify guidance from the toy manufacturer or choose a lubricant specifically intended for that material type.

How much liquid silk lubricant should I use?

Start with a small amount and apply gradually. Many users find that light coverage is enough to create a comfortable glide, and reapplying in the friction zone is more efficient than applying too much at once. If the feel becomes dry or inconsistent, add a little more rather than increasing suddenly.

How should I clean toys after using lubricant?

Cleaning should follow the toy care guidance for the material. In general, remove residue first, then wash with a compatible cleaner, rinse if needed, and dry thoroughly. Proper drying reduces buildup and helps maintain the toy surface for future use.

What if the lubricant feels tacky or changes texture?

Tackiness can result from residue buildup, an incompatible material interaction, or using too much at once. Stop use, clean the toy thoroughly, and allow it to dry. Then re-test with a smaller amount, or switch to a formulation that better matches the toy material.
